The Role

Mach is building the next generation of autonomous defense systems—designed, manufactured, and deployed at speed. Our team operates at the intersection of hardware, software, and mission execution to deliver scalable, decentralized capabilities that deter conflict and strengthen allied advantage.

We are seeking an Soft Structures Engineer to lead the design, analysis, and development of our lighter-than-air (LTA) platforms. This role sits at the core of our vehicle architecture—owning the structural, material, and pressure-driven behavior of balloon-based systems from concept through flight.

You will work hands-on with soft materials, high-performance fabrics, and pressurized systems, translating first-principles physics into manufacturable, flight-ready hardware.

Key Responsibilities
  • Own the end-to-end design of balloon envelopes, including geometry, material selection, and structural architecture.

  • Perform detailed analysis of pressurized and unpressurized systems, including stress, creep, fatigue, and failure modes.

  • Design for manufacturability, including seaming, patterning, joining methods, and production constraints.

  • Develop and execute test campaigns (ground + flight) to validate models and iterate rapidly.

  • Work cross-functionally with mechanical and manufacturing teams to integrate envelope systems into full vehicles.

  • Build internal tools and frameworks for simulation, sizing, and performance prediction.

  • Drive rapid iteration cycles from prototype to deployment in a fast-paced environment.

Required Qualifications
  • Experience with soft goods / flexible structures (e.g., fabrics, membranes, composites, inflatables, parachutes, sails, balloons, etc.)

  • 1+ years of experience in mechanical engineering, with a focus on designing and prototyping mechanical systems (can be in a professional, hobby or academic setting)

  • Strong skills in 3D modeling and CAD tools (e.g., NX, SolidWorks, etc.) for mechanical design and iteration.

  • Experience with programming languages (e.g. python, MATLAB, C++) for analytical modeling, simulation and engineering problem-solving.

  •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or a related field.

  • Demonstrated experience owning hands-on, end-to-end hardware development efforts (e.g., FSAE, DBF, Rocket Team, or similar projects).

Preferred Qualifications
  • Background in high-altitude or atmospheric systems.

  • Familiarity with textile engineering, coatings, or permeability/diffusion modeling.

  • Experience designing for extreme environments (thermal, UV, pressure cycling).

  • Knowledge of seaming, bonding, and joining techniques (RF welding, heat sealing, adhesives, stitching) and their structural implications.

  • Experience modeling or testing membrane structures under load, including wrinkling, creep, and long-term deformation

  • Familiarity with coatings and barrier layers, including permeability, gas retention, and environmental degradation (UV, moisture, temperature cycling)

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
